Carbonio Systemd
Targets#
To facilitate modular deployment and management, Carbonio introduces
four dedicated systemd
targets that group services by host
role. Each target defines a set of related .service
units and
manages them as a logical group:

Two key units (carbonio-configd.service
and
carbonio-stats.service
) are shared across all targets and play
foundational roles in configuration generation and monitoring.
Systemd
vs. zmcontrol#
Systemd
and the legacy zmcontrol
domain are mutually
exclusive: you cannot use both at the same time.
If any systemd
target is enabled, attempting to run zmcontrol
or any legacy control script will produce a warning message.
Warning
Similarly, attempting to start a service with
systemctl
on Ubuntu 22.04 or Red Hat 8 infrastructure (thus
with the services still managed by zmcontrol
) will lead to
failed startup of services and possible damage done to the
infrastructure.
Technical Highlights#
carbonio-configd.service
is a prerequisite for most services; it must be up to provide generated configuration.All services wait for the unit
carbonio-configd.service
before starting.The only exception is
carbonio-openldap.service
, which can start independently.LDAP availability is checked before
carbonio-configd.service
activates.Only
carbonio-directory-server.target
can safely start withoutcarbonio-configd
.
